Based on graph 1 do you think the changes in solar intensity are a significant cause of the trend in global Temperatures why or why not

Answers

Changes in solar intensity do not seem to contribute to the change in global temperatures. If they did, the temperatures would rise and fall with the Sun’s energy. Instead, the global temperatures continue to rise despite the Sun’s natural fluctuations.

What is the global temperature record?

The global temperature record shows the fluctuations in the temperature of the atmosphere and the oceans through various periods. There are numerous estimates of temperatures since the end of the Pleistocene glaciation, particularly during the current Holocene epoch.

Some temperature information is available through geologic evidence, going back millions of years. More recently, information from ice cores covers the period from 800,000 years before the present time until now. A study of the paleoclimate covers the period from 12,000 years ago to the present. Tree rings and measurements from ice cores can give evidence about the global temperature from 1,000-2,000 years before the present until now.

The most detailed information exists since 1850 when methodical thermometer-based records began.

What happens when a bank is required to hold more money in reserve?


It has less money for loans


It has less money for operations


It has less money for interest payments


It has less money for withdrawals

Answers

Answer:

The correct answers are (A) and (C)

Explanation:

When a commercial bank is required to hold more money in reserve, this is usually a government or central bank policy (contractionary monetary policy) to reduce the amount of money in circulation.

The bank will then have less money to loan out and also less money to pay interest on loans. This gives the answers (A) and (C).

As for (B) and (D), cash-reserve ratio does not affect the basic flow of money in bank operations and a bank can't have less money for its customers to withdraw just because they are required to hold more money in their reserve. Every saver or customer remains entitled to all the money he saves in the bank.

The line of longitude 135 E. runs through....would it be India japan or vietnam

Answers

Answer:

The Chinese city of Chongqing might be japan!

Explanation:

The 135°E meridian of longitude crosses several oceans and seas, and also parts of these land masses . . .

-- Siberia (Russia)

-- Japan

-- Pulau

-- Papua

-- Australia

-- Antarctica

The line comes within 11 miles of one point in China, but it never actually crosses any Chinese territory.

It doesn't come anywhere near any part of India or Vietnam.
